  • Canadian and U.S. Export Control Policy. Foreign Affairs and International Trade Canada (DFAIT) will host a seminar on February 3, 2011 on Canadian and U.S. Export Control Policy. There will also be seminars just on Canada's export controls on February 2 and 3, 2011.
  • Asian Gypsy Moth. The Canadian Food Inspection Agency (CFIA) issued a directive, effective January 10, 2011, on Asian Gypsy Moth (Lymantria Dispar L.). This directive prescribes measures to prevent the entry by vessels and establishment of Asian gypsy moth in Canada.
